Signature Names Former Azamara and Royal Executive Michelle Lardizabal as Chief Marketing & Sales Officer

by Daniel McCarthy  April 15, 2026
Michelle Lardizabal headshot

Michelle Lardizabal

Signature Travel Network on Wednesday rounded out its leadership team with the appointment of 25-year travel industry veteran Michelle Lardizabal as Chief Marketing & Sales Officer.

Lardizabal, who concludes her tenure as CSO at Azamara on May 1, will officially join Signature on May 11. In her new role, she will report to President Karryn Christopher and oversee Signature’s global partnership portfolio, including cruise, hotel, and land suppliers.

Beyond partnerships, Lardizabal will also be tasked with evolving Signature’s data strategy and multi-channel marketing—spanning digital, social, and emerging technologies like artificial intelligence.

She joins a growing team of vice presidents, including Christine Conklin (Marketing), Jordin Greene (Hotel Partnerships), and Jill Saliba (Head of Analytics), among others. She also joins an evolving Signature leadership team that is highlighted by Christopher’s appointment as president last year.

“Signature’s reputation, culture, and momentum make it an incredibly compelling organization,” said Lardizabal. “From the strength of its member network to the depth of its preferred partnerships, Signature has built a truly differentiated consortia in the industry. I’m excited to collaborate with this talented team and build on its strong foundation to help further elevate the ways we support our members and partners. Together, we have a meaningful opportunity to drive continued innovation, strengthen strategic relationships, and deliver even greater value across the network as we look to the future.” 

Lardizabal’s resume includes more than a decade at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d., as well as leadership stints at MSC Cruises and Club Med. She currently serves as co-chair of the CLIA Trade Relations Committee and is a founding board member of Women Leading Travel & Hospitality.

Her first appearance in the new role will be at Signature’s Regional Management meetings beginning May 18 in Fort Lauderdale.
